What Does a Title Company Actually Do?
A title company examines public records to confirm a property has a clear ownership history. They check for liens, unpaid taxes, and any ownership disputes. This process protects both the buyer and the lender.
Title companies also manage the closing process. They collect and distribute funds, prepare closing documents, and record the deed with the county. Without them, real estate transactions would carry significant legal risk.
In Oklahoma, title insurance is common practice. The title company issues a policy that protects you if a past ownership problem surfaces after closing. That coverage can save you thousands of dollars in legal fees.
How to Start Your Search for a Title Company in Bartlesville
Start with a simple Google search for title companies in Bartlesville, Oklahoma. Look at results that include reviews, ratings, and a physical local address. Avoid companies that operate only online with no local presence.
Ask your real estate agent for recommendations. Agents work with title companies regularly. They know which companies close on time and which ones cause delays. A trusted agent referral saves you significant research time.
You can also ask friends or family who have recently bought property in the area. Personal referrals carry real weight. People share honest opinions when money and property are involved.
Check the Oklahoma Insurance Department
Oklahoma regulates title insurance companies through the Oklahoma Insurance Department. You can visit their website and verify that any title company you consider holds a valid license. This step takes only a few minutes.
Licensed companies follow state rules that protect consumers. If a company cannot show proof of licensing, walk away. Working with an unlicensed title company puts your entire transaction at risk.
You can also check the Better Business Bureau for complaints. Look for patterns of poor communication or delayed closings. A few complaints over many years may be normal, but a pattern signals a real problem.

Questions to Ask Before You Choose a Title Company
Call at least three title companies before making your decision. Ask each one how long they have operated in Bartlesville. Local experience matters because Oklahoma property law has specific requirements.
Ask about their average closing timeline. Most residential closings should take between 30 and 45 days. If a company quotes significantly longer timelines, ask why. Delays cost everyone time and money.
Ask who will handle your specific file. Some large companies assign different staff members at each stage. You want a single point of contact who knows your transaction from start to finish.

Understanding Title Insurance Costs in Oklahoma
Title insurance in Oklahoma follows a rate schedule set by the state. Rates are based on the purchase price of the property. You should receive the same base rate from any licensed company in Bartlesville.
However, closing fees can vary between companies. These include document preparation fees, wire fees, and courier charges. Always request a complete fee estimate before you commit to any title company.
Compare the full closing disclosure from each company side by side. Small fees add up quickly. A company that charges slightly more per service could cost you hundreds of extra dollars at closing.
Local Title Companies vs. National Chains
Bartlesville has both local independent title companies and branches of national chains. Each option carries advantages. Local companies often offer more personalized service and faster communication.
National chains may have more technology resources and streamlined processes. However, they sometimes assign your file to staff who have never visited Oklahoma. Local knowledge matters in real estate transactions.
Many experienced buyers and real estate professionals in Bartlesville prefer working with locally owned title companies. They understand Washington County property records and local customs around closings.

Final Tips for Choosing the Right Title Company
Trust your instincts when you speak with title company staff. If they explain things clearly and respond quickly to your questions, that is a good sign. Poor communication before closing usually gets worse during closing.
Read every document the title company provides. Do not rush through closing paperwork. A reputable title company will give you time to review everything and answer all your questions before you sign.
